Category: Power & Plyometrics

Power & Plyometrics are essential for rugby players. Converting strength and movement fundamentals into power and explosiveness turns good players into exceptional athletes! Power and explosiveness are what allows players to create space, break tackles and dominate breakdowns!We believe that all rugby players can become more powerful and reap the benefits of increased explosiveness on the rugby field!This library of resources give you all the information needed to increase power and plyometric ability! Training techniques, sample programs, periodisation and detailed look at key training techniques and exercises are all included.This collection of power and plyometrics articles, videos and training programs have been designed using all of our years of experience of working with rugby players all over the world to optimise their training and maximise their performances on the rugby field.It is our mission to provide rugby players with the tools and information that are usually restricted to players in full time environments.
